NSMQ 2025: Double Qualification Joy For Ejisuman SHS And Nsutaman Catholic In Ashanti Clash

Published

on

Ejisuman Senior High School and Nsutaman Catholic SHS have both booked spots at the 2025 NSMQ national championship after a thrilling contest in the Ashanti Regional Qualifiers.

Ejisuman SHS secured a well-deserved victory with an impressive 46 points, while Nsutaman Catholic SHS, although finishing second, earned qualification after posting a strong 41 points, enough to advance to both zonal championship and nationals. Mansoman SHS followed with 32 points, while Barekese SHS placed fourth with 25 points.

This marks a significant comeback for Ejisuman SHS, who competed in the 2024 national championship but exited at the preliminary stage after losing to Archbishop Porter Girls’ SHS.

For Nsutaman Catholic SHS, the qualification ends a long wait since their last appearance at the national level in 2019.

The school has consistently participated in the regional qualifiers but narrowly missed out on national qualification in 2021 and 2023, including a tiebreaker loss as a runner-up in 2021.

NSMQ 2025: Brilliance On Display As Four Schools Advance In Volta Regional Qualifiers

Published

on

The heat is officially on in the Volta Region as the 2025 edition of the National Science and Maths Quiz regional qualifiers picked up steam on Tuesday, July 22. The second day of contests served drama, excitement, and fierce academic battles as students competed with everything on the line, a chance to make it to the national stage.

In Contest 4, St. Paul’s SHS, Denu made their intentions clear from the start, dominating the round with an impressive 57 points. Their performance left no doubt, brushing aside Agotime SHS (25 points) and Battor SHS (22 points). It was a clear-cut victory that showed just how prepared St. Paul’s is for this year’s competition.

Contest 5 brought a nail-biting showdown between Tsito SHS and St. Catherine Girls’ SHS. The two schools were neck and neck all through, but Tsito managed to edge it with 38 points, narrowly beating St. Catherine Girls’ who ended with 36 points. Peki SHS couldn’t quite catch up and finished with 17 points, but the fight between the top two had everyone at the edge of their seats.

Hohoe E.P. SHS completely stole the spotlight in Contest 6 with a commanding performance. They racked up 65 points, comfortably ahead of Battor SHS (28 points) and Akatsi SHS (25 points). It was a statement win that firmly places Hohoe E.P. as one of the top teams to watch from the region.

Closing out the day was Contest 7, where Awudome SHS secured their spot with a solid 48 points. St. Catherine Girls’ SHS, making their second appearance of the day, once again showed resilience, scoring 41 points but narrowly missing out on qualification. Keta Business College managed 18 points in a round that showcased Awudome’s depth and determination.

From nail-biting finishes to dominant wins, Day 2 of the Volta Regional Qualifiers had it all. The atmosphere was electric, the competition fierce, and the passion unmatched. Prempeh College Crowned Champions of 2025 Luv FM High School Debate

Published

on

Prempeh College has emerged as the champions of the 2025 Luv FM High School Debate, defeating Kumasi High School in a thrilling grand finale that captivated audiences across the Ashanti Region and beyond.

Debating the motion, “Politicians are more corrupt than civil servants,” both schools delivered compelling arguments, showcasing deep research, critical thinking, and persuasive speaking.

Ultimately, Prempeh College won the day with a final score of 231 points (50.22%), narrowly edging past Kumasi High School, who secured 229 points (49.78%). The victory came by majority decision, with 2 out of 3 judges awarding the contest to Prempeh College.

Organized by Luv FM, a member of the Multimedia Group Limited, in collaboration with the Ghana Education Service (GES), the debate provided a powerful platform for young intellectuals to engage on pressing societal issues. This year’s motion stirred thought-provoking discussion around ethics, governance, and public service in Ghana.

The final was a display of high-level debating, with both schools receiving commendation for their eloquence, structure, and analytical depth. However, Prempeh College’s refined delivery and ability to effectively rebut key points proved decisive in the eyes of the judges.

Their victory adds to their distinguished record in academic and extracurricular excellence, further cementing their reputation as a powerhouse in student leadership and discourse.

Over 19,700 Students Receive Second Semester Loans – Dr Saajida Shiraz

Published

on

The Acting Chief Executive Officer of the Students Loan Trust Fund (SLTF), Dr. Saajida Shiraz, has confirmed that SLTF recently disbursed second-semester loans to 19,703 students across 135 public and private institutions.

Speaking at the launch of the No Fee Stress initiative, Dr. Shiraz highlighted that this marks the first time in four years the fund has paid second-semester loans.

She also revealed that first-semester loans have already been disbursed to 38,440 students across 145 institutions this academic year.

“The Student Loan Trust Fund Board this year has disbursed first-semester loans to a total of 38,440 students across 145 public and private institutions,” Dr. Shiraz stated.

“For the first time in four years, we have begun paying second-semester loans,” she continued. “Just three days ago, 19,703 students from 135 institutions received their loans.”

Acknowledging past challenges, Dr. Shiraz said, “The days when loans were approved but not disbursed, and the complacency that hindered the fund’s core mandate, are now behind us.” She confidently affirmed, “The challenges we faced in meeting our core mandate are a thing of the past.”

Dr. Shiraz also expressed profound appreciation to the GET Fund Administrator for their unwavering support. “I appreciate the GET Fund Administrator for privatizing the tertiary education reset agenda and committing the necessary funds to help SLTF meet its commitments.”

Established to expand access to higher education, the Students Loan Trust Fund (SLTF) provides crucial financial support to students in both public and private institutions by offering loans that cover tuition fees and other educational expenses.

Over the years, SLTF has played a vital role in enabling thousands of students to afford tertiary education, thereby contributing significantly to national development through investment in human capital.
